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u accepted US President Joe Biden's proposal to send a delegation to Washington to discuss plans for military operations in Rafah.

Axar.az reports that this was stated by the US President's national security assistant Jake Sullivan.

According to him, the American president asked Netanyahu to send an interagency team to the US capital to discuss the situation in Rafah and to plan an alternative approach without a major ground operation.

"The prime minister (Netanyahu - ed.) has agreed. He will send a team to Washington to discuss this issue," Sullivan said.
